Home
last modified time | relevance | path

Searched refs:ObjectData (Results 1 – 11 of 11) sorted by relevance

/third_party/vk-gl-cts/modules/gles3/performance/
Des3pDepthTests.cpp92 struct ObjectData struct
97ObjectData (const ProgramSources& shader_, const Geometry& geometry_) : shader(shader_), geometry(… in ObjectData() function
103 RenderData (const ObjectData& object, const glu::RenderContext& renderCtx, TestLog& log);
113 RenderData::RenderData (const ObjectData& object, const glu::RenderContext& renderCtx, TestLog& lo… in RenderData()
472 inline ObjectData quadWith (const glu::ProgramSources& shader, float depth) in quadWith()
474 return ObjectData(shader, getFullscreenQuad(depth)); in quadWith()
477 inline ObjectData quadWith (const string& fragShader, float depth) in quadWith()
479 …return ObjectData(glu::makeVtxFragSources(getBaseVertexShader(), fragShader), getFullscreenQuad(de… in quadWith()
482 inline ObjectData variableQuad (float depth) in variableQuad()
484 …return ObjectData(glu::makeVtxFragSources(getInstanceNoiseVertexShader(), getDepthAsRedFragmentSha… in variableQuad()
[all …]
/third_party/node/deps/v8/src/compiler/
Dheap-refs.cc81 class ObjectData : public ZoneObject { class
83 ObjectData(JSHeapBroker* broker, ObjectData** storage, Handle<Object> object, in ObjectData() function in v8::internal::compiler::ObjectData
150 class HeapObjectData : public ObjectData {
152 HeapObjectData(JSHeapBroker* broker, ObjectData** storage,
156 ObjectData* map() const { return map_; } in map()
162 ObjectData* const map_;
167 PropertyCellData(JSHeapBroker* broker, ObjectData** storage,
177 ObjectData* value() const { in value()
184 ObjectData* value_ = nullptr;
217 PropertyCellData::PropertyCellData(JSHeapBroker* broker, ObjectData** storage, in PropertyCellData()
[all …]
Drefs-map.h16 class ObjectData; variable
33 : public base::TemplateHashMapImpl<Address, ObjectData*, AddressMatcher,
45 ObjectData* Remove(const Address& key);
Djs-heap-broker.h174 ObjectData* GetOrCreateData(Handle<Object> object, in DEFINE_OPERATORS_FOR_FLAGS()
176 ObjectData* GetOrCreateData(Object object, GetOrCreateDataFlags flags = {}); in DEFINE_OPERATORS_FOR_FLAGS()
180 ObjectData* TryGetOrCreateData(Handle<Object> object, in DEFINE_OPERATORS_FOR_FLAGS()
182 ObjectData* TryGetOrCreateData(Object object, in DEFINE_OPERATORS_FOR_FLAGS()
373 friend class ObjectData; in DEFINE_OPERATORS_FOR_FLAGS() local
479 TraceScope(JSHeapBroker* broker, ObjectData* data, const char* label) in TraceScope()
520 JSHeapBroker* broker, ObjectData* data) { in TryMakeRef()
537 ObjectData* data = broker->TryGetOrCreateData(object, flags);
548 ObjectData* data = broker->TryGetOrCreateData(object, flags);
Drefs-map.cc12 base::TemplateHashMapImpl<Address, ObjectData*, AddressMatcher,
30 ObjectData* RefsMap::Remove(const Address& key) { in Remove()
Dheap-refs.h46 class ObjectData; variable
166 using data_type = ObjectData; \
203 explicit TinyRef(ObjectData* data) : data_(data) { DCHECK_NOT_NULL(data); }
204 ObjectData* const data_;
221 ObjectRef(JSHeapBroker* broker, ObjectData* data, bool check_type = true)
265 ObjectData* data() const;
266 ObjectData* data_; // Should be used only by object() getters.
327 Name##Ref(JSHeapBroker* broker, ObjectData* data, bool check_type = true) \
Dper-isolate-compiler-cache.h20 class ObjectData; variable
Djs-heap-broker.cc186 ObjectData* JSHeapBroker::TryGetOrCreateData(Object object, in TryGetOrCreateData()
191 ObjectData* JSHeapBroker::GetOrCreateData(Handle<Object> object, in GetOrCreateData()
193 ObjectData* return_value = TryGetOrCreateData(object, flags | kCrashOnError); in GetOrCreateData()
198 ObjectData* JSHeapBroker::GetOrCreateData(Object object, in GetOrCreateData()
/third_party/skia/third_party/externals/dawn/src/dawn_wire/server/
DServer.cpp49 ObjectData<WGPUDevice>* device = DeviceObjects().Get(deviceId); in InjectTexture()
54 ObjectData<WGPUTexture>* data = TextureObjects().Allocate(id); in InjectTexture()
81 ObjectData<WGPUDevice>* device = DeviceObjects().Get(deviceId); in InjectSwapChain()
86 ObjectData<WGPUSwapChain>* data = SwapChainObjects().Allocate(id); in InjectSwapChain()
109 ObjectData<WGPUDevice>* data = DeviceObjects().Allocate(id); in InjectDevice()
157 ObjectData<WGPUDevice>* data = DeviceObjects().Get(id); in GetDevice()
DObjectStorage.h55 struct ObjectData : public ObjectDataBase<T> {}; struct
60 struct ObjectData<WGPUBuffer> : public ObjectDataBase<WGPUBuffer> {
86 struct ObjectData<WGPUDevice> : public ObjectDataBase<WGPUDevice> {
96 using Data = ObjectData<T>;
/third_party/skia/third_party/externals/swiftshader/third_party/llvm-10.0/llvm/lib/Object/
DMachOUniversal.cpp69 StringRef ObjectData; in getAsObjectFile() local
72 ObjectData = ParentData.substr(Header.offset, Header.size); in getAsObjectFile()
75 ObjectData = ParentData.substr(Header64.offset, Header64.size); in getAsObjectFile()
79 MemoryBufferRef ObjBuffer(ObjectData, ObjectName); in getAsObjectFile()
90 StringRef ObjectData; in getAsArchive() local
92 ObjectData = ParentData.substr(Header.offset, Header.size); in getAsArchive()
94 ObjectData = ParentData.substr(Header64.offset, Header64.size); in getAsArchive()
96 MemoryBufferRef ObjBuffer(ObjectData, ObjectName); in getAsArchive()